From 275aa892c30e91adfec9276f6d6845756b141c62 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Arne Schwabe Date: Thu, 18 Jan 2024 14:55:30 +0100 Subject: [PATCH] Remove conditional text for Apache2 linking exception With the reimplementation of the tls-export feature and removal/approval or being trivial of the rest of the code, now all the code falls under new license. Remove the conditional text of the license to be only valid for parts of OpenVPN.
